suggestion from field trialer:please take a look at the Tarpin Hill company's 
new website.I think most of you would really like this particular company's 
trooper saddles,most probably the new Endurance model.Roger Shuler,the owner,is 
an enthusiastic guy who will rig/equip to YOUR selections as to 
rigging,stirrups,stirrup leather,etc. The T.Hill seems to be becoming the most 
popular make of trooper saddle among field trialers.I think they are more 
comfortable than the others.I'd suggest going with the unpadded seat,but most 
folks go for the padded.
